Abstract (en)
[origin: WO2022003299A1] The invention relates to a device (D) for fastening together two components (A and B) to be joined, the device comprising a connection rod (1) comprising two ends, a first end being fastened to a first component, the second end extending through the second component, the second end being provided with a bearing surface. This device is characterised in that it comprises a clamping wedge (7) which is associated with the second component (B) and which is movable relative to the second component along an axis which is not parallel with the longitudinal axis of the connection rod (1) and which is provided in an inclined plane (71), the wedge (7) being interposed between the bearing surface of the second end of the connection rod (1) and the surface of the second component so that, during its movement, the wedge (7), by means of its inclined plane, applies an axial constraint to the connection rod (1) and ensures that the two components (A and B) are fastened together.
